What Happened ??
Is it just me or does it seem like more of the C5 and C6 owners just don't care to assoicate with lower C's ?? You do get a few waves or a thumbs up when you pass by each other or pull up next to one at a stoplight, but on the most part it seems like you don't exist, (I'm not even going to mention about most of the Vipers). It seems that more none vette owners like to make contact as you travel down the roads. I always had great repect for people who own cool cars. I had to wait 30 years to get the car I always wanted. When I was younger (maybe its an age thing), 99.9% of vette, rods, and just about anything else that was cool always gave encouragement to the other guy.

it just depends on the person driving it. (C5 C6) I waved at a c6 owner the other day and he looked at me like I was crazy. About an hour later we both pulled into the same gas station. He walked up to me and said "Nice car" which I nodded and said thanks. He then said "I keep having guys in other vettes waving at me, am I doing something wrong?" I said "No man, it is just a wave of respect and acknowledgement from the brotherhood of vette owners."
He looked at me and said "good, I thought I was doing something wrong"
As stupid as this sounds, not all vette owners know about the wave. Sometimes it is not a sign of being an AXX it is just ignorance.
